Default Coolant disappearing after I thought I was fine?

Well after tearing down my engine a second time to get rid of the leaking cometic gaskets, I got the heads milled 24 thousandths and used stock GM mls gaskets this time around.

Well I drove the car a handfull of times checking the coolant after each drive and it seemed to be fine but this week I drove the car with a couple of pulls and didn't check the coolant after the drive since I got sick. Well I finally got better and checked the level a week later and it was slightly under the coils in the radiator! If I had to guess it needed around 15 ounces.

There is nothing on the floor, not a drop. I still have the same amount of coolant in my reserve also, I also don't smell any coolant burning when driving, I'm getting nervous with college starting soon since it's my DD.

have you checked all the hoses? even the 2 small hoses that go to the throttle body? I had a small tear in one of those after I did the TB bypass mod and it drained my coolant completely!
